Java数据库编程实践教程第五章详解

需积分: 5 0 下载量 116 浏览量 更新于2024-10-19 收藏 2.27MB ZIP 举报
资源摘要信息:"在IT专业教育课程中,'Accp8.0\S2\使用Java实现数据库编程 第五章' 提供了一个专门针对Java语言进行数据库编程的学习模块。该模块不仅包含课堂教学资料,还配有上机练习和课后作业,为学习者提供了全面的实践机会。Java作为一种跨平台、面向对象的开发语言,广泛应用于企业级应用、Android开发等众多领域,数据库编程是其重要技能之一。数据库编程涉及到如何利用Java语言连接和操作数据库,如常见的关系数据库MySQL、Oracle等。本章节可能涵盖了数据库连接池的使用、SQL语句的执行、事务的处理等高级话题。通过本章节的学习,学习者应能够熟练掌握Java数据库编程的基本技能,并能够解决实际开发中的问题。 根据标签内容,我们可以确定本章节的主题是围绕Java语言及其在数据库编程方面的应用。Java语言是后端开发中非常重要的开发语言之一,它由Sun Microsystems公司(现为甲骨文公司的一部分)于1995年发布。Java之所以受到开发者的青睐,主要归功于其安全性、跨平台兼容性和面向对象的编程范式。 数据库作为现代应用程序不可或缺的一部分,负责存储、管理和检索数据。在本章节的学习中,可能会涉及以下知识点: 1. JDBC(Java Database Connectivity)API:JDBC是Java的一个核心库,它提供了一组API来连接和执行查询到各种类型的数据库。学习JDBC的基本使用方法,理解其架构,如何通过JDBC API建立数据库连接、执行SQL语句以及处理结果集等。 2. 数据库连接池(Connection Pooling):数据库连接池是一种用于提高数据库操作效率的技术。它预先创建一定数量的数据库连接,并在程序运行过程中重用这些连接。了解连接池的工作原理和优势,学习如何在Java中配置和使用连接池。 3. SQL语句执行:掌握如何在Java程序中编写和执行SQL语句。学习不同类型SQL语句的使用,包括数据查询语言DQL(例如SELECT语句),数据操纵语言DML(例如INSERT、UPDATE、DELETE语句)等。 4. 事务处理:理解事务的概念和重要性。学习如何在Java代码中控制事务的边界,包括事务的提交和回滚。掌握如何设置事务隔离级别以及处理事务时可能遇到的异常。 5. 数据库设计和模型:了解关系型数据库的基础知识,如表、关系、主键、外键、索引等。学习如何设计数据库模式以及如何将其转换为Java中的数据模型。 6. 上机练习和课后作业:通过上机实操加深对理论知识的理解。完成特定的数据库编程任务,如创建表、插入数据、查询数据、更新数据和删除数据等。课后作业可能包括更复杂的场景模拟,提升解决实际问题的能力。 标签中提到的'apache'可能指的是Apache开源项目,虽然它与本章节的主题不直接相关,但在实际开发中,Apache软件基金会提供了多种与Java和数据库相关的开源工具和库,例如Apache Commons、Apache Derby等。这些工具可以辅助Java开发人员更好地进行数据库编程。 综上所述,'Accp8.0\S2\使用Java实现数据库编程 第五章' 是一个专门针对Java语言数据库编程的综合学习模块,它提供了从基础知识到高级应用的全面覆盖,学习者通过理论学习和实践操作能够有效地提升自身的Java数据库编程技能。"